**Ticket: Spoolhawk jobs stuck in PENDING after retry storm**

Support team: customers on the Fenwick tier report print jobs sitting in PENDING indefinitely. Root cause appears to be the Spoolhawk microservice retrying a dead renderer node instead of failing over. Workaround: ask customers to cancel and resubmit; engineering is patching the health check. When escalating, include the affected job ID and the build trace token shown directly below.

trace token, kawip-fafog: htk14_26e64c4d35154e

# Limits and Quotas: Reminder Job

The nightly reminder job for the Bellgrove clinic scheduler sends SMS and email notices for upcoming appointments. To avoid flooding the gateway and tripping carrier spam filters, the job enforces hard per-run caps and a per-patient daily quota. If a run hits a cap, remaining reminders roll to the next cycle rather than being dropped, so maintainers should resist raising limits to "catch up." Changes require sign-off from the messaging owner. The enforced limits are defined below.

tuning constants:
QUOTAS = {
    "druwyn": 5,
    "holix": 5,
    "zorath": 5,
    "holwyn": 10,
}

Ticket FM-2281: The summer intern cohort for Brightlea Analytics arrives Monday at the Fennel Street office. Twelve interns total, starting in the third-floor open area. Team assistants should collect welcome packs from the mailroom before 9:00 and escort interns from the lobby. Temporary badges are pre-printed; desks are labelled. Until individual badges are activated, escorts should use the shared door-pass code below.

door code, bageg-bajof: bdg-IU-0

Key ceremony checklist — item 7 (Ostlund Systems). Before sealing shares, confirm the cron drift investigation is closed: scheduler nodes on the Brimwald cluster were drifting 40s due to a stale NTP peer, now corrected. Verify all ceremony hosts agree within 100ms. Once verified, unlock the ceremony escrow drive using the passphrase recorded below.

recovery phrase for bawef-kagug: casix-tamvan-lamath-holeth-gilmir-drudor-julax-wenok-wenael-rusvan-holax-goriel-frawyn